The Epworth score is a screening tool for daytime sleepiness. This may be caused by obstructive sleep apnoea (OSA) but may be due to other causes.

The screening tool for OSA is the STOPBANG score.

Paully there is only one OSA which is where you stop breathing in your sleep. Some but not all sufferers are tired in the morning and nod off in the day. It can cause many problems and as you say carries a risk, but if treated these risks fall away.

The best way to get help is a referral to a sleep clinic (only a sleep study can give a definitive diagnosis) or failing that an ENT surgeon. Self prescribing CPAP may not be the best idea. It is also a significant risk in relation to a general anaesthetic so many anaesthetic preassessment clinics also have an interest in the condition.
